Davide Frattesi from Sassuolo has long been a goal for Rome, who is working to bring him to the club. The Giallorossi are looking for mid-season reinforcements for José Mourinho. In order to reach an agreement that allows Frattesi to join the capital club in January. The representatives of Rome and Sassuolo are expected to meet next week. The Giallorossi are also preparing a contract extension for the Italian midfielder until 2027.
Davide Frattesi could move to his Boyhood Club Roma
Frattesi followed in the footsteps of his hero, Rossi. Having risen quickly through Roma’s youth divisions. But in 2017, when the player was 18 years old, his hopes were dashed when he was transferred for 5 million euros to Sassuolo. After a series of loan periods with Ascoli, Empoli, and Monza. Frattesi made his debut last season, logging nearly 3,000 league minutes while also contributing four goals and three assists.
Naturally, the Frattesi have won the hearts of many Serie A teams. But because of their loyalty to Roma, the Giallorossi may have the upper hand in the competition for the 23-year-old’s services. old
The Italian network reported that Roma and Sassuolo would meet next week to discuss a possible transfer of Frattesi. That, according to Angelo Mangiante’s tweet, could materialize during the January transfer window. Mangiante makes the speculative claim that Jose Mourinho and the Roma hierarchy see Frattesi as the ideal midfield partner for Georginio Wijnaldum, benching either Bryan Cristante or Nemanja Matic in the process.
